A FOAF was considering getting somekind of air purifier/HEPA, not for inoculation purposes but for keeping a sterile workspace/fruiting environment. Is this worth it or should they just stick with disinfectant?

The truth is that it's during the colonizing stage that contaminants are a problem so unless you want to get sterile air during your glovebox time or spawning it's a complete waste. Once the mushrooms have the substrate the only thing that will give contaminants the upper hand in taking over is if the mycilium exhausts the nutrients. There is no point in trying to integrate sterile air conditions into your operations after the substrate is colonized.
BTW: the two people here with HEPA filters just got them cause they were cheap... tell you anything in that? It's not necessary for glovebox or spawning work.
